Never use a public computer when you are away from home to check your bank accounts. There is something called a keylogger that scam artists will use to gain access to your banking information as you type the keys on the computer.

Some countries will certainly not have 5 star amenities available. In cases where you are in an under developed country, you may choose to bring something with you to help secure your door from the inside. A simple door stop will do the trick. These handy little gadgets made of wood or rubber are usually intended to hold a door open, however they can also hold them closed.

Take sleeping pills if you need helping sleeping through a flight. It can be very hard to get sleep on a plane with all the noise, the different surroundings, and the uncomfortable seats. Try a sleeping pill might help get you some rest on a long flight if you have trouble falling asleep otherwise. Always wait until you are safely in the air before taking your sleeping pill because delays can happen or planes can be grounded.

When traveling internationally, it is a good idea to prepare for unexpected events, like misplacing your passport. You can get steps on contacting the embassy in the country in which you are traveling by visiting usembassy.state.gov. Department of State uses the site (usembassy.state.gov)and affords you contact and location information for the US Embassy and Consulate within the country you are visiting. Bring this information with you on your trip. In the majority of cases, a passport replacement is ready within a couple of days.

Write reminders of things you don’t want to leave behind in your room when you depart by using a dry-erase marker on the bathroom mirror. A paper note can easily get lost, but a note written on a mirror is hard to ignore. Clean up is simple; just use a tissue.
